"Trump's Dual Strategy: Messaging, Rhetoric, and 2024 Election Trail"

TL;DR Summary
Donald Trump plans to campaign in Michigan and Wisconsin while facing legal challenges, including an upcoming hush-money trial. His team aims to highlight President Biden's "Border Bloodbath" and leverage the trial to rally support. Despite the trial's potential impact on his campaign schedule, Trump's team is confident in their messaging and fundraising capabilities. Meanwhile, Biden has been actively visiting battleground states to boost his poll numbers and contrast his activity with Trump's legal distractions.
